Photography training courses
Digital photography for beginners (9-12 hours, about 3/4 classes of 3 hours each)
It’s dedicated to all the photographers who are switching from film to digital. You will learn the simplest way to take advantage of your digital camera and the simplest software techniques to get the the best results.
What is the resolution of a digital image and why should I care
Raw vs Jpeg: which format and why
What is a ‘digital image compression’
What is an histogram what is it helpful for
Managing the white balance
ISO and digital noise
Archiving and managing your photos with metadata
Using the basic tools of a photo manipulation software
